Description
"Street scene, Mokelumme Hill," 1936
Oil on board
Signed and dated lower left: Gagliani / 36, titled and dated again on a canvas label affixed verso
16" H x 20" W
Notes: Presented in a Mayen Olson frame.
Mokelumne Hill is the western-most Gold Rush era town in Calaveras County, CA.
